Wincenty Witos Monument (Polish: Pomnik Wincentego Witosa) is a monument in Warsaw, Poland, placed at the Three Crosses Square, within the Downtown district. It consists of a bronze statue of Wincenty Witos, a statesman and politician, who was the Prime Minister of Poland from 1920 to 1921, in 1923, and in 1926. It was designed by Marian Konieczny, and unveiled on 22 September 1985.
